title = "Epithelial cell proliferation of the colonic mucosa in diverticular disease: a case-control study",
abstract = "A higher risk of both advanced adenoma and carcinoma occurs in the sigmoid colon of patients with diverticular disease, for which bacterial carcinogens have been claimed to play a role.",
